The 99 K2500 Suburban was just a treat I bought myself this summer.....my daily driver for 10 years has been a 1987 1/2 Suburban 350/700R4 (I still have it). It has 300k on it now and the engine has never been touched. Runs like a top and no leaks!!!!Never left me on the side of the road but I wanted something a little fresher to pull my car trailer. I did NOT want a 4x4 but I just could not find a good deal on a low mile 2x4 with a good color, a 5.7 and I really wanted a 373 rear. Ended up with a 4x4, 5.7 with a 4.11. Oh well. Another reason I insisted on a 3/4 ton was I refuse to deal with this "sham" here in the metro Atlanta area called emmissions testing. The GVW exceeds it by 50 pounds so I dont have to get one. I have converted all of my fleet to vehicles that dont need emmissions testing. Either older than 25 years, over the GVW rating or diesels (AKA-boat anchors) I do have a 1991 Honda Accord with 183,000 miles but emmisions has never been an issue and I cant bring myself to sell it..its to good a car for the wife. |

watahyahknow,
they are warn 4x flares. Might be hard to find not sure, we got the last set advance auto had listed in their system, one set they had, the other had to be shipped here. had a set on our s-10 too, got in a wreck with it, on the pass. side, only put the paint of the other guys truck on the flare, came right off, we had them painted white to match the truck, and the pass. fender was all crunched up but the flare was still in its original shape. no cracks or anything, pretty durable IMO. |
